fre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

《vb程序設(shè)計教程集》ppt課件-預(yù)覽頁

2025-06-05 04:54 上一頁面

下一頁面
 

【正文】 x≥0 True False 例如:計算分段函數(shù) y = 本題在選擇條件時,可以選擇 x0作為條件,也可以選擇 x≥0作為條件。其語句形式為: If 表達(dá)式 1 Then 語句塊 1 ElseIf表達(dá)式 2 Then 語句塊 2 … [Else 語句塊 n+1] End If Visual Basic 首先測試 表達(dá)式 1。 表達(dá)式 1 語句塊 1 表達(dá)式 2 語句塊 2 …… 語句塊 n 語句塊 n+1 表達(dá)式 n 圖 413 多分支結(jié)構(gòu)流程 False True True False True False 語句塊 n+1 語句塊 n 2)2(21)2)(1(11?????????xxxxxxx例 45:利用 If...Then...Else 語句編寫求函數(shù) y = 的值的程序,要求只要在文本框 Text1中輸入自變量 x的值,就在標(biāo)簽欄 label1上顯示函數(shù)值。 將字符串類型轉(zhuǎn)化為雙精度類型 If (x 1) Then y = 1 x ElseIf (x = 1 And x = 2) Then y = (1 x) * (2 x) Else y = (2 x) End If = y 39。 ( 4)獎勵按特等獎、優(yōu)秀獎、特別獎由高到低,不重復(fù)計獎(包括單科)。 設(shè)計步驟如下: ( 1)建立應(yīng)用程序用戶界面 按如圖 419建立四個文本框( Text1~Text4)接受成績輸入,兩個標(biāo)簽控件( Label1~Label2),一個命令按鈕 Command1,設(shè)置各控件的屬性,其中Command1的 Caption屬性值為“查詢”??筛鶕?jù)實際情況選擇采用何種結(jié)構(gòu)。 ( 1)設(shè)計流程圖 根據(jù)題意,畫出如圖 420所示流程圖。如果不止一個 Case與 測試表達(dá)式 相匹配,則只對第一個匹配的 Case 執(zhí)行與之相關(guān)聯(lián)的 語句塊 。試根據(jù)此表編寫程序。Label1~ Label5的 Caption屬性依次為:“請輸入日期”、“月”、“日”、“請輸入訂票數(shù)”、“張”, Label6的 Caption屬性設(shè)計時為空白,運(yùn)行時用來顯示優(yōu)惠率。 Trim()) Select Case strdate Case 428 To 431, 51 To 57, 928 To 931, 101 To 107 If intnn = 30 Then intss = 35 Else intss = 15 Case 71 To 79, 710 To 731, 81 To 89, 810 To 831 If intnn = 30 Then intss = 30 Else intss = 20 Case Else If intnn = 30 Then intss = 25 Else intss = 10 End Select = 您所訂機(jī)票優(yōu)惠率為: amp。 Private Sub Text1_Click() = = = End Sub Private Sub Text2_Click() = End Sub Private Sub Text3_Click() = End Sub 此外,還應(yīng)為每一個文本框的鍵盤按下事件編寫如下代碼,表明當(dāng)按回車鍵時,自動跳到下一個必要的控件: Private Sub Text1_KeyPress(KeyAscii As Integer) If KeyAscii = 13 Then End Sub Private Sub Text2_KeyPress(KeyAscii As Integer) If KeyAscii = 13 Then End Sub Private Sub Text3_KeyPress(KeyAscii As Integer) If KeyAscii = 13 Then End Sub 7月 ~8月 30 10 日期 =30 30 =30 30 =30 35 15 30 20 10 4/28~5/7, 9/28~10/7 =30 月 月圖 424機(jī)票優(yōu)惠率計算流程圖 其他 滿足條件 =30 =30 25 30 30 30 10 30 20 35 15 條件函數(shù) 1. IIf 函數(shù) 2. Choose函數(shù) IIf 函數(shù)的功能是根據(jù)表達(dá)式的值,來返回兩部分中的其中一個。當(dāng) strDay的值不在 1~5之間時,返回 NULL。根據(jù)題意和要求可先求出 ...1...2111 222 ???? n ( 1)設(shè)計流程圖 根據(jù)題目要求,設(shè)計出如圖 425所示的流程圖。 控件 Caption屬性值 Label1 運(yùn)算次數(shù) Label2 近似值 Picture1 空白(設(shè)計時) Picture2 空白(設(shè)計時) Command1 求 π 的近似值 表 46 求 π的近似值應(yīng)用程序控件屬性值 ( 3)編寫代碼 根據(jù)流程圖編寫 Command1_click事件的代碼如下: Private Sub Command1_Click() Dim sum As Double, temp As Double, pi As Double Dim i As Double sum = 0 temp = 1 i = 1 圖 426 求 π的近似值的程序運(yùn)行結(jié)果 Do While (temp = ) sum = sum + temp i = i + 1 temp = 1 / i / i Loop pi = Sqr(6 * sum) i 。 ( 1)設(shè)計流程圖 根據(jù)題目要求,設(shè)計出如圖 427所示的流程圖。這種形式保證 循環(huán)體 至少執(zhí)行 1次,其語法格式為: Do 循環(huán)體 Loop [{While | Until} 循環(huán)條件 ] 輸入 m, n m存放大數(shù) ,n存放小數(shù) 輸出 n 求 m/n的余數(shù) m←n 數(shù) n←r 的余數(shù) 例 411:求兩個正整數(shù) m和 n的最大公約數(shù)。 ( 4)最后的 n即為最大公約數(shù)。有時,循環(huán)的次數(shù)是已知的,這時最好使用 For...Next 循環(huán)。 ( 1)設(shè)計流程圖 根據(jù)題意,設(shè)計如圖 434所示流程圖。 j amp。 Private Sub Command1_Click() 循環(huán)嵌套 在一個循環(huán)體內(nèi)又出現(xiàn)另外的循環(huán)語句稱為循環(huán)嵌套。因此,可以用如下嵌套的循環(huán)作為對一個節(jié)點(diǎn)的描述: For i=1 to 9 For j=1 to i 循環(huán)體 Next j Next i 這里, 循環(huán)體 為乘法等式: expss = i amp。 i * j。 j amp。 Next j Next i End Sub 圖 435 乘法九九表( 2) For Each...Next 循環(huán)與 For...Next 循環(huán)類似,但它對數(shù)組或?qū)ο蠹现械拿恳粋€元素重復(fù)一組語句,而不是重復(fù)語句一定的次數(shù)。例如: 1+11+111+… +111111(此時 n=6)。 b amp。 tn amp。) 分析:三位數(shù) n中的每一位上的數(shù)可以這樣來表述: 百位 i : i=int( n/100) 十位 j : j=n/10i 10 個位 k : k=n Mod 10 編寫 Command1_click的代碼如下: Private Sub Form_Click() Dim i As Integer, j As Integer, k As Integer, n As Integer 圖 437 求水仙花數(shù)程序運(yùn)行情況 For n = 100 To 999 i = Int(n / 100) j = Int(n / 10) i * 10 k = n Mod 10 If n= i * i * i + j * j * j + k * k * k Then Print n。 )( 00xf xf求出 d和新的 x的值 x1。 Val(), x=。求三種短料各多少根,使得所剩材料最少? Private Sub Command1_Click() Dim a As Integer, b As Integer, c As Integer, sum As Integer Dim n1 As Integer, n2 As Integer, n3 As Integer, temp As Integer Sum = 10000 For c = 13 To 10000 / 177 For b = 17 To 10000 / 133 c For a = 15 To 10000 / 112 b c temp = 10000 c * 177 b * 133 a * 112 If temp = 0 And temp Sum Then Sum = temp: n1 = a: n2 = b: n3 = c End If Next Next Next Print n1=。 a, b=
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1